Prim算法的大规模图计算并行算法.pptx

Prim算法的大规模图计算并行算法.pptx

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

Prim算法的大规模图计算并行算法

Prim算法并行在计算方法上具备什么优势?

Prim算法基于什么原理对大规模图执行计算?

算法在图计算并行中如何利用优先队列?

Prim算法的并行方法如何确保算法在分布式计算中正确终止?

算法的全局和局部变量如何帮助分布式并行计算?

基于Prim算法设计的并行算法如何处理图中的闭合环?

算法的并行实现如何克服负载不平衡挑战?

如何对Prim算法并行设计进行实验评估?ContentsPage目录页

Prim算法并行在计算方法上具备什么优势?Prim算法的大规模图计算并行算法

Prim算法并行在计算方法上具备什么优势?分布式计算:1.将大规模图数据分布于多台计算节点,通过并行计算解决大规模图计算问题。2.减少数据传输,提高计算效率,并行计算能够有效利用多核处理器的计算能力,提高算法的运行速度。3.可扩展性强,易于实现分布式计算,能够适应不同规模的图计算问题。消息传递:1.节点间通过消息传递来交换信息,节点只与相邻节点通信,减少通信开销。2.使得算法具有较高的并行性,能够充分利用计算资源,节省计算时间。3.易于实现,可扩展性强,能够适应不同规模的图计算问题。

Prim算法并行在计算方法上具备什么优势?高效数据结构:1.使用高效的数据结构来存储图数据,如邻接表、邻接矩阵等,能够快速查询节点之间的连接关系。2.减少算法的运行时间,提高算法的效率。3.易于实现,能够适应不同规模的图计算问题。负载均衡:1.将计算任务合理分配给各个计算节点,以确保计算资源的有效利用。2.避免计算节点出现负载过重或过轻的情况,提高计算效率。3.易于实现,能够适应不同规模的图计算问题。

Prim算法并行在计算方法上具备什么优势?快速收敛:1.采用快速收敛的贪心算法,能够快速找到近似最优解,减少算法的运行时间。2.提高算法的效率,能够处理大规模图计算问题。3.易于实现,能够适应不同规模的图计算问题。高容错性:1.能够容忍计算节点的故障,不会导致算法的失败,提高算法的稳定性。2.能够自动处理故障节点,无需人工干预,减少维护工作量。

Prim算法基于什么原理对大规模图执行计算?Prim算法的大规模图计算并行算法

Prim算法基于什么原理对大规模图执行计算?最长边算法:1.Prim算法基本上是一个贪婪算法,它通过迭代地选择最短的剩余边来最小化跨越图中所有顶点的边权和来工作。2.最长边算法是Prim算法的一个变体,它通过迭代选择最长的剩余边来最大化跨越图中所有顶点的边权和来工作。3.在大规模图形计算中,最长边算法通常比Prim算法更有效,因为在每次迭代中添加的边的权重较高,从而导致更快的收敛。最小生成树:1.Prim算法和最长边算法都用于找到图中的最小生成树(MST),MST是一个连通子图,其中任何两个顶点都是通过权重最小的边连接的。2.最小生成树对于许多应用非常有用,例如网络路由、最小成本路径规划以及聚类和分组任务。3.Prim算法和最长边算法都是常用的找到最小生成树的算法,但最长边算法通常在稀疏图上表现得更好。

Prim算法基于什么原理对大规模图执行计算?并行算法:1.在大规模图形计算中,为了提高性能,通常使用并行算法,即算法可以在多台计算机上同时运行。2.Prim算法和最长边算法都可以并行化,这可以通过将图分解成多个子图,然后将这些子图分配给不同的计算机来实现。3.Prim算法和最长边算法的并行化可以显着提高性能,特别是对于大型图形。动态规划:1.Prim算法和最长边算法都可以表述为动态规划问题,动态规划是一种用于解决优化问题的技术,它通过将问题分解成一系列子问题并存储子问题的解决方案来工作。2.Prim算法和最长边算法的动态规划形式非常相似,这使得可以将相同的算法用于解决这两个问题。3.将Prim算法和最长边算法表述为动态规划问题可以使算法更容易理解和分析,并且可以帮助开发更有效的并行算法。

Prim算法基于什么原理对大规模图执行计算?启发式算法:1.Prim算法和最长边算法都是启发式算法,启发式算法是一种用于解决优化问题的技术,它使用一系列启发式规则来引导搜索过程。2.Prim算法和最长边算法的启发式规则很简单,但非常有效,这使得它们成为解决最小生成树问题的热门选择。3.Prim算法和最长边算法的启发式规则可以针对不同的图类型进行调整,这可以进一步提高算法的性能。应用:1.Prim算法和最长边算法在许多应用中都有应用,包括网络路由、最小成本路径规划,以及聚类和分组任务。2.Prim算法和最长边算法也被用于解决许多其他优化问题,例如旅行商问题和车辆路径规划问题。

算法在图计算并行中如何利用优先队列?Prim算法

文档评论(0)

布丁文库 + 关注
官方认证
内容提供者

该用户很懒,什么也没介绍

认证主体 重庆微铭汇信息技术有限公司
IP属地重庆
统一社会信用代码/组织机构代码
91500108305191485W

1亿VIP精品文档

相关文档